Rhino viruses typically cause common colds. in a test of the effectiveness of echinacea, 39 of the 45 subjects treated with echinacea developed rhinovirus infections. in a placebo group, 87 of the 101 subjects developed rhinovirus infections. use a 0.01significance level to test the claim that echinacea has an effect on rhinovirus infections. complete parts (a) through (c) below. a. test the claim using a hypothesis test. consider the first sample to be the sample of subjects treated with echinacea and the second sample to be the sample of subjects treated with a placebo. what are the null and alternative hypotheses for the hypothesis test? a. h0: p1 = p 2h1: p 1 β‰  p2b. h0: p1 β‰  p 2h1: p 1 = p2c. h0: p1 greater then or equal to p 2h1: p 1 β‰  p2d. h0: p1 = p2h1: p1 < p 2e. h0: p 1 ≀ p 2h1: p 1 β‰  p 2f. h0: p1 = p 2h1: p1 > p2
b. identify the test statistic. z= (round to two decimal places as needed.)
c. identify the p-value. p-value= (round to three decimal places as needed.)
